σαγάνι

Greek

Alternative forms

Etymology

From Turkish sahan (dish, pan), from Arabic صَحْن (ṣaḥn). Compare Greek τηγάνι (tigáni, frying pan) and Ancient Greek τήγανον (tḗganon) or τάγηνον (tágēnon).

Noun

σαγάνι (sagáni) n (plural σαγάνια)

  1. double-handled frying pan
